深入了解TokenIM离线授权:实现安全高效的身份验

                    发布时间:2025-10-24 22:39:13
                    ### 内容主体大纲 1. 引言 - TokenIM的背景介绍 - 离线授权的必要性和优势 2. 什么是TokenIM? - TokenIM的定义 - TokenIM的工作原理 - TokenIM与传统授权方式的对比 3. 离线授权的概述 - 离线授权的定义 - 离线授权的场景应用 - 离线授权的优势 4. TokenIM离线授权的实现 - 离线授权的基本流程 - TokenIM如何支持离线授权 - 示例操作步骤 5. 离线授权的安全性 - 离线授权的安全挑战 - TokenIM如何确保离线授权的安全性 - 实际应用中的安全案例分析 6. TokenIM离线授权的应用案例 - 企业级应用 - 个人用户场景 - 开发者视角 7. 常见问题解答 - TokenIM离线授权的适用场景有哪些? - TokenIM离线授权的安全性如何保障? - 在开发中如何实现TokenIM的离线授权? - 离线授权与在线授权的优缺点对比? - 如何处理离线授权后生成的Token? - TokenIM如何与其他身份验证系统集成? - 问题7:用户在使用TokenIM离线授权时的注意事项? --- ### 引言

                    在数字化和互联网高速发展的今天,安全性和便捷性成为用户和企业都极为关注的关键因素之一。身份验证作为连接用户与服务的重要环节,其安全性和效率直接影响用户体验和业务发展。在这一背景下,TokenIM凭借其创新的离线授权机制,以简便、高效、安全的特点,受到越来越多开发者和企业的青睐。

                    本篇文章将深入探讨TokenIM的离线授权机制,分析其在身份验证中的优势和应用场景,帮助读者全面了解这一技术如何提升安全性和用户体验。

                    ### 什么是TokenIM? #### TokenIM的定义

                    TokenIM是一种基于Token的身份验证系统,旨在为用户提供安全、高效的认证服务。与传统的用户名/密码身份验证方式相比,TokenIM通过生成一次性Token来验证用户身份,降低了信息泄露的风险。

                    #### TokenIM的工作原理

                    TokenIM的工作原理是通过生成Token来替代用户凭证。用户在登录时,系统会根据用户输入的信息生成一个加密的Token,并将其发送至用户的设备。用户在后续的访问中可以使用该Token进行身份验证,避免了频繁输入密码的麻烦。

                    #### TokenIM与传统授权方式的对比

                    传统的身份验证方式如用户名和密码,不仅易于被攻击者窃取,还常常导致用户因密码管理不当而面临安全风险。而TokenIM则通过动态生成Token并进行加密,有效提升了安全性。此外,用户体验也得到了显著改善,减少了因密码遗忘导致的困扰。

                    ### 离线授权的概述 #### 离线授权的定义

                    离线授权是指在没有网络连接的情况下,授权用户访问特定资源或服务。通过这种方式,用户即使身处无网络环境,也能够灵活地使用所需的功能,确保服务的连续性。

                    #### 离线授权的场景应用

                    离线授权广泛应用于各种场景。例如,在旅行时,用户可能无法连接到互联网,但仍希望使用地图或导航功能。此时,离线授权可以确保他们在没有网络的情况下获得精准的信息和服务。

                    #### 离线授权的优势

                    离线授权最显著的优势在于其提升了用户的灵活性和便利性。用户不再受限于网络环境,可以随时随地使用服务。此外,离线授权还降低了服务器负担,降低了对网络可靠性的依赖,提高了系统整体的稳定性。

                    ### TokenIM离线授权的实现 #### 离线授权的基本流程

                    离线授权的基本流程通常包括几个关键步骤:用户请求授权、系统生成Token、用户进行操作、系统校验Token和更新授权时间戳等。这一系列步骤必须确保安全性和高效性,才能实现顺利的离线操作。

                    #### TokenIM如何支持离线授权

                    TokenIM通过生成用户特定的Token并将其存储在用户设备上,支持离线授权。当用户没有网络时,依然可以使用该Token进行身份验证,享受无缝的服务体验。TokenIM利用加密技术,确保Token在存储和使用过程中的安全性。

                    #### 示例操作步骤

                    具体操作中,用户可以通过安装应用程序进行离线授权。用户在首次登录时,系统会生成Token,并将其保存在用户本地。随后,即使没有网络连接,用户仍然能利用该Token高效地访问所需的服务。

                    ### 离线授权的安全性 #### 离线授权的安全挑战

                    虽然离线授权带来了便利,但也面临着一系列安全挑战。如Token的存储和使用可能被恶意软件攻击,导致Token被盗用。此时,用户的数据和身份安全将受到威胁。

                    #### TokenIM如何确保离线授权的安全性

                    TokenIM采用多种加密技术和安全机制,如多重身份验证、有效期管理和令牌失效机制等,确保离线授权的安全性。通过设定Token的使用时间限制和访问权限,最大限度地减少潜在风险。

                    #### 实际应用中的安全案例分析

                    在某公司的实际应用中,通过实现TokenIM的离线授权机制,成功地方便了员工的出差管理。当员工在未经网络的情况下,需要验证身份时,TokenIM的安全设计确保了信息安全,且有效避免了潜在的数据漏洞。

                    ### TokenIM离线授权的应用案例 #### 企业级应用

                    许多企业在进行数字化转型时,尤其在涉及外部员工和合作伙伴时,发现离线授权可以显著提高工作效率。通过TokenIM,这些企业在不同场景下,如远程工作、出差等,都能够灵活运用离线授权。

                    #### 个人用户场景

                    个人用户同样可以从中受益。在无网络的情况下使用社交应用、阅读离线资料等,TokenIM的离线授权确保这些操作的顺畅和安全,让用户尽享方便。

                    #### 开发者视角

                    对于开发者而言,TokenIM提供的离线授权机制为其产品增加了一层价值。通过实现这一机制,开发者在设计时不仅需考虑用户的便利性,还需兼顾到系统的安全性。

                    ### 常见问题解答 #### TokenIM离线授权的适用场景有哪些?

                    TokenIM离线授权的适用场景十分广泛,包括但不限于移动设备应用程序、企业内部系统访问、短期项目管理和临时户外活动等。在这些情况下,用户常常面临网络环境不稳定的挑战,离线授权能够大幅提高产品的灵活性和用户满意度。

                    #### TokenIM离线授权的安全性如何保障?

                    离线授权面临的最大挑战之一就是数据安全。TokenIM使用加密算法确保Token在生成、存储和使用过程中的安全性。同时,系统会定期审查Token的有效性,确保已失效的Token不能再次被使用。此外,监测异常活动也是保障安全的重要手段。

                    #### 在开发中如何实现TokenIM的离线授权?

                    实现TokenIM的离线授权通常需要开发者在应用程序中集成相关的SDK或API。开发者需关注Token的生成、存储和验证逻辑,确保其在离线环境中的适用性。同时,应采取必要的错误处理和异常管理机制,提升用户体验。

                    #### 离线授权与在线授权的优缺点对比?

                    离线授权的优点在于提升了灵活性和可用性,适用于网络不稳定的情况。然而,其缺点则包括安全风险的增加和管理 Token 的复杂性。在线授权则通常依赖实时验证机制,安全性更高,但在网络不佳时可能导致用户 experiência 下降。

                    #### 如何处理离线授权后生成的Token?

                    离线授权后生成的Token需设定有效期,确保其在合理时间内有效。在Token过期后,系统应提示用户进行重新授权。此外,对于已使用的Token,应及时进行注销处理,避免重复使用问题。

                    #### TokenIM如何与其他身份验证系统集成?

                    TokenIM能够与现有身份验证系统进行无缝集成。通过定义标准接口和协议,开发者可在不影响原有架构的基础上,快速实现TokenIM的离线授权功能,提高系统的可扩展性和灵活性。

                    #### 问题7:用户在使用TokenIM离线授权时的注意事项?

                    用户在使用TokenIM的离线授权时,应注意保护自己的设备和Token信息。为确保安全,用户应定期更新Token并保持软件更新到最新版本。此外,了解Token的有效期和使用限制,避免因失效造成的进出权限丢失。

                    ### 结语

                    TokenIM的离线授权机制为用户提供了更为安全和便捷的身份验证方式,凭借其在多个场景下的实际应用,展示了其广阔的发展前景。随着技术的不断进步,离线授权的安全性和效率也将不断提高,为更多用户创造更为良好的数字体验。

                    深入了解TokenIM离线授权:实现安全高效的身份验证深入了解TokenIM离线授权:实现安全高效的身份验证
                    分享 :
                                    author

                                    tpwallet

                                    T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                                      相关新闻

                                                      Tokenim:揭示去中心化金融
                                                      2025-05-14
                                                      Tokenim:揭示去中心化金融

                                                      内容主体大纲:1. **引言** - 什么是Tokenim? - Tokenim在去中心化金融中的角色2. **Tokenim的基本特点** - 去中心化 - 透明性...

                                                      如何安全有效地使用Toke
                                                      2025-06-25
                                                      如何安全有效地使用Toke

                                                      ## 内容大纲1. 引言 - 介绍Tokenim和MToken的概念 - 当今加密数字资产管理的重要性2. Tokenim苹果版(MToken)概述 - 应用功能...